Why This Project Matters

Founded in 2019, Telerepair has grown into a trusted electronics repair company with shops in Roskilde, Lyngby, Hørsholm, and Copenhagen. Known for fast, reliable service and a green mindset of repair over replacement, the company serves both private and business customers.

Yet despite strong values and skilled staff, Telerepair lacked a clear and recognizable digital identity. In a market with fierce competition, this limited their ability to connect with customers online, build trust, and stand out as a sustainable alternative to larger repair chains. Strengthening communication and online presence became essential for scaling growth.

Our Approach

With support from Aalborg Institute for Development through SMV:Digital, Telerepair launched a digital transformation project focused on three key areas:

  • Interactive Online Platform – creating a user-friendly website where customers can easily book repairs, find information, and communicate directly with the team.

  • CRM Integration – implementing advanced customer management tools to personalize communication, track customer needs, and improve service quality.

  • Social Media Strategy – moving from a passive online presence to a structured approach with targeted content, campaigns, and digital storytelling to build a recognizable, human-centered brand.

Process Automation – integrating digital tools to streamline operations, making it possible to serve more customers without losing quality.

Results

A stronger and more consistent online identity.
A new digital platform improving customer experience and accessibility.
CRM tools enabling personalized communication and better customer insights.
Increased engagement and visibility through structured social media strategies.
Automated internal processes boosting efficiency and scalability.

Aalborg Institute for Development’s Role

As the SMV:Digital supplier, AID guided Telerepair through advisory workshops, strategic planning, and implementation support. We ensured the company had the knowledge and tools to sustain their new digital systems, from CRM to content marketing, creating long-term independence and resilience.
